    How We Picked

    These coolers were selected based on a combination of performance, durability, usability, and value. Priority was given to insulation quality—how long they keep ice—and build strength, especially for rugged outdoor use. Ease of transport, capacity, and additional features like dry storage or wheels also influenced ranking. We balanced these factors against price to highlight options suitable for various budgets and needs, aiming to provide a clear hierarchy of the best highend options for different types of campers.

    Factors to Consider When Choosing Highend Camping Coolers

    Choosing a highend camping cooler involves weighing several important factors beyond just size and price. Understanding these can help you avoid common pitfalls like overpaying for features you won’t use or selecting a model that doesn’t suit your trip length or terrain. The right cooler depends on your specific needs—whether you prioritize ice retention, portability, or durability. Below are key considerations to guide your choice, ensuring you pick a cooler that performs reliably on your outdoor adventures.

    Insulation Performance

    Insulation is the backbone of any highend cooler. The thicker and more advanced the insulation, the longer your ice will last, even in hot weather. Look for rotomolded construction and high-quality foam, which typically outperform cheaper, foam-only models. Be mindful that increased insulation often adds weight and cost, so balance these factors based on how long you’ll need to keep items cold and how portable your cooler needs to be.

    Build Durability

    Highend coolers are designed to withstand tough conditions, so durability is key. Rotomolded shells, heavy-duty latches, and reinforced hinges are signs of rugged construction. Such features prevent cracking or breaking during transport and rough handling. Remember, a more durable cooler might be heavier, so consider your ability to carry or wheel it in your typical camping environment.

    Size and Capacity

    Choosing the right size depends on trip length and group size. Larger coolers hold more ice and supplies but tend to be heavier and bulkier. Smaller, portable models are easier to carry but may require more frequent ice replacements. Think about whether you’ll need a cooler for day trips or multi-day adventures, and pick a size that balances capacity with ease of transport.

    Portability and Features

    Features like wheels, handles, and shoulder straps significantly impact ease of carrying. Wheeled models are convenient for car camping but can be cumbersome on uneven terrain. Also, consider additional features such as dry storage compartments, drainage systems, and locking mechanisms, which can add convenience and security. Be cautious not to prioritize features that may add unnecessary weight or complexity if portability is your main concern.

    Price and Value

    While highend coolers tend to be more expensive, investing in quality often pays off through longer ice retention and durability. However, it’s wise to evaluate whether the added features justify the price for your specific needs. For instance, a premium model with exceptional ice retention may be worth the cost for extended trips, but if you only camp occasionally, a slightly less expensive model may suffice. Focus on the core features that matter most for your outdoor style.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    How long can a highend camping cooler keep ice?

    Most highend camping coolers are designed to keep ice for at least 5-7 days under typical conditions. Factors such as outside temperature, frequency of opening the cooler, and initial ice amount influence this. Premium models like the YETI Tundra 65 often outperform others, reaching 7 days or more in moderate heat. Proper loading—filling the cooler completely—also helps maximize ice retention, so plan accordingly for your trip length.

    Are wheeled coolers better than non-wheeled options?

    Wheeled coolers offer significant convenience, especially when transporting heavy loads over flat terrain. They reduce strain and make loading and unloading easier. However, on uneven or rugged ground, wheels can become obstacles or break more easily. If your camping involves rough terrain, a sturdy, non-wheeled cooler with handles might be more reliable, but for car camping or flat surfaces, wheels are a smart feature to consider.

    Is it worth paying extra for rotomolded construction?

    Yes, rotomolded construction greatly enhances durability and insulation performance. These coolers are less prone to cracking and can withstand rough handling, making them suitable for demanding outdoor conditions. The tradeoff is weight—rotomolded models tend to be heavier—and cost. For serious adventurers or extended trips, investing in rotomolded coolers can be worthwhile, especially if you expect rough transport or frequent use.

    Should I prioritize capacity or portability?

    This depends on your typical camping style. Larger coolers provide more space for food, drinks, and ice, making them ideal for multi-day trips or groups. However, they are heavier and less portable. Smaller units are easier to carry and maneuver but may require more frequent ice replacements. Balance your trip duration and physical handling ability to choose a size that fits your needs without sacrificing convenience.

    How much should I expect to spend on a highend cooler?

    Highend coolers typically range from around $200 to over $500, with premium rotomolded models like YETI Tundra 65 or Pelican 70 Quart often at the top end. The price reflects insulation efficiency, durability, and extra features. Consider your planned usage: if you need a cooler for frequent, long trips, investing more can translate into better performance and longevity. Conversely, occasional campers might find mid-range models offer a good balance of features for less money.
